Mastermix Classic Cuts is the most successful unmixed single-track compilation series in DJ history. For over three decades, this definitive collection has served as the backbone for mobile, wedding, and radio DJs worldwide. Spanning Volumes 1 through 100, the complete anthology represents a masterclass in music curation, delivering pristine, radio-edit, and extended versions of the most requested floor-fillers of all time.
